My oddest one is www.signdomains.com out of New Delhi India. If you go to upper left side and click-on Renew Your Domain and next enter the domain ALREADY reg'd there, instead of a renewal form coming up a transfer-in form comes up for transfering the name to them?

Tried many times and it happens over and over again on each of the domains Pool.com grabbed thru them, even though all are in fact already reg'd there, as verified by Whois. All support requests on this issue are ignored. Does not appear to be any way to renew the names. Very worried as some are expiring soon.

The mystery is how are these 3rd-rate registrars so successful at grabbing the names but so terrible at managing them and simply making sure their website works? How do firms like that manage to stay in business?

Yep, RGNames (Namewinner partner when I got the name I have there) is one of the primary problem children out there. I still have a name stuck there that I can't get out. They keep rejecting all transfer requests for no apparent reason and sending me notes written in Korean.

I have been in touch with a lot of people since that editorial came out. Can't say anything publicly yet, but looks like there is a good chance some of these registrars will be receiving pink slips from the dropcatchers they currently work for. If that happens it will be interesting to see if competing dropcatchers pick them up (as that would be a clear admission that they don't give a rat's a*s about what their customers have to go through).
